> > 2. Where should I update the firmware files? Is the path the
> > linux-2.6/firmware?
>
> ! This directory is only here to contain firmware images extracted from old
> ! device drivers which predate the common use of request_firmware().
>
> It is fine for the existing code.
>
> > However, according to linux-2.6/firmeware/README.AddingFirmware, I
> > should update they to another repository:
> >
> > git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/dwmw2/linux-firmware.git
>
> /me scratches head.
>
> Assuming Realtek does not intend to stand this code / data as GPLable, yes.
> It will help people staying clear from non-free code, it will help packaging
> something useful and it will remove some cruft from the code.
>
> So everybody will end happy. Especially after an aspirin.

The plan is to do away with linux-2.6/firmware entirely.
Distributions are shipping the firmware from linux-firmware, not the
kernel files.
